 DISSERTATION RESEARCH ACCOMPLISHMENTS

Designed new type of fluorescent ligand that binds to lanthanide metals. Created lanthanide metal complexes with a photoluminescence and electroluminescence. Synthesized ligands that incorporate polycyclic aromatic compounds and dendritic functionality for use as a light harvesting material.

Studied the effect of curricular changes on general chemistry by examining the effect of early introduction of Bonding Theory/Lewis Structures in General Chemistry. Created and implemented new inquiry based laboratory materials for use in the General Chemistry Curriculum. Studied the effect of these materials on student performance and retention.

Made new type of interpenetrating polymer network consisting of Poly-Vinyl Pyridine and Poly-Phenylene Oxide that showed no phase separation and high thermal stability.
